Which of the following is a function of iodine?
A
Glucose metabolism.
B
Thyroid hormone synthesis.
C
Oxygen transport.
D
B vitamin synthesis.
Verified step by step guidance
1
Understand the role of iodine in the body: Iodine is an essential trace mineral primarily involved in the synthesis of thyroid hormones, which regulate metabolism, growth, and development.
Eliminate incorrect options: Glucose metabolism is primarily regulated by insulin and other hormones, not iodine. Oxygen transport is facilitated by hemoglobin in red blood cells, which requires iron, not iodine. B vitamin synthesis is not dependent on iodine; B vitamins are obtained from dietary sources.
Focus on the correct function: Iodine is a critical component of the thyroid hormones thyroxine (T4) and triiodothyronine (T3). These hormones are synthesized in the thyroid gland and require iodine for their production.
Relate iodine deficiency to thyroid function: A lack of iodine can lead to hypothyroidism or goiter, which are conditions caused by insufficient thyroid hormone production.
Conclude that the correct answer is 'Thyroid hormone synthesis,' as this is the primary and well-established function of iodine in human nutrition.
